DESCRIPTION:Join Dana Gayner\, a local artist\, and create your own handcrafted “secret wallet” Valentine booklet with hidden panels and personalized messages. $7 for the public\, FREE for members.\n \nBio of Dana Gayner \nAfter attending the Philadelphia College of Art\, Dana began a teaching career at Woodland Country Day School that lasted 26 years.  She became involved with Gallery 50 in 1981\, becoming president of the non-profit for 8 years.  She has organized and judged many art shows.  Her work has been shown in the tri-state area\, and she has presented workshops for local schools\, libraries and Gallery 50\, Inc.  She had been a regular presenter for  the Friends Conference for Religion and Psychology\, and their sister conference in Washington\, DC.  While she enjoys painting in watercolor and acrylics\, she also works with semi-precious beads to design necklaces and bracelets.  While  attending the Artist/Teacher Institute at Rutgers in Camden\,  she was able to study book arts for many years with the University of the Arts professor\, Mary Phelan.  Her favorite type of book to make is the “Magic Wallet” book\, which lends itself to all occasions.

While you’re here\, take in the scenic views and spend time with friends and family. \nAt 6:30 PM\, guest speaker Dave McCarthy from the Millville Army Air Field Museum will present on the history of the Millville Army Air Field. This site is known as “America’s First Defense Airport” and was established in 1941. \nDuring its operation\, over 100\,000 men and women served there. In addition\, more than 1\,500 pilots trained on site in fighter aircraft. Today\, the museum preserves this important part of South Jersey history. \nYou can purchase food and drinks throughout the event.
